When discussing global health challenges, breast cancer remains one of the most frequently diagnosed malignancies worldwide. In clinical oncology pathways, when dealing with locally advanced stages, healthcare professionals routinely deploy neoadjuvant chemotherapy as a key initial intervention strategy. This systematic treatment is carefully administered prior to the main surgical procedure to effectively minimize the overall size of the tumor mass within the patient’s body.
To monitor whether the ongoing therapy is working successfully, the medical community relies extensively on objective laboratory markers. One of the most widely recommended and frequently used tumor markers to evaluate treatment progress is the serum CA 15-3 examination. CA 15-3 is a mucinous antigen naturally produced by normal breast cells. However, in the presence of breast cancer, this structural protein is heavily over-expressed and spreads widely across the cellular membranes, entering the vascular system. Consequently, tracking its concentration in the bloodstream provides a vital parameter to monitor the disease course and evaluate active responses to therapeutic agents.
Clinical trial evaluations conducted in specialized hospital environments demonstrate a direct and strong positive correlation between a drop in this tumor marker and the success of chemotherapy sessions. Upon completing the second cycle of neoadjuvant chemotherapy, a significant reduction in serum CA 15-3 levels from the pre-treatment baseline is typically observed. This biochemical decline directly mirrors a measurable decrease in the physical diameter of the targeted tumor lesions. This reliable relationship provides oncologist teams with critical predictive insights regarding patient prognosis, helping them optimize subsequent care pathways.
Generally, the optimal reference interval for CA 15-3 levels in healthy individuals is established below 30 U/mL, with approximately 95% of well women testing within this healthy range. It is also essential to note that mild elevations of this circulating antigen can occasionally manifest due to other non-malignant conditions, including chronic liver disorders, benign lung complications, or naturally during the third trimester of pregnancy.
